How much do weekend typing j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average yearly pay for weekend typing in Norwalk, CT is $53,479.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,200.00 and $60,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a weekend typing?

A Weekend Typing job involves typing or data entry tasks that need to be completed on weekends. These jobs can include transcribing documents, entering data into databases, or formatting text. They are often remote and flexible, making them ideal for students, freelancers, or anyone looking for extra income. Employers may require typing speed and accuracy, along with basic computer sk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in weekend typing?

To thrive as a Weekend Typing professional, you need excellent typing speed and accuracy, attention to detail, and basic computer proficiency, often demonstrated through prior clerical or administrative experience. Familiarity with word processing software like Microsoft Word or Google Docs and, in some cases, experience with data entry platforms or transcription tools is beneficial. Dependability, time management, and effective communication are valuable soft skills in this position. These skills ensure work is completed efficiently, accurately, and within tight weekend deadlines, often with limited oversight.

What are the typical work hours and expectations for weekend typing?

Weekend Typing roles are usually structured around Saturday and Sunday shifts, which may be full- or part-time, depending on the employer's needs. You can expect responsibilities such as transcribing documents, entering data, formatting reports, or supporting administrative projects with timely and accurate typing. Many of these positions offer remote or flexible work arrangements, though some require being present in an office environment for collaboration or access to confidential materials. Clear communication and meeting quick turnaround times are often key expectations, as weekend projects may contribute to productivity goals or weekly reporting cycles.
